#0f6dcd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f6dcd is composed of 5.9% red, 42.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.7%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#0f6dcd color hex could be obtained by blending #1edaff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0f6dcd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f6dcd has RGB values of R:15, G:109,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1011149.

Shades and Tints of #0f6dcd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f6dcd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6e70 is the less saturated color, while #076dd5 is the most saturated one.
